Zaïbo weather in March

In March, Zaïbo sees average daytime highs of 34°C and overnight lows near 24°C, with 93 mm of rain across 15.5 wet days and about 12 hours of daylight. It is the 2nd-warmest and 8th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 34°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 9% of the time in March, and the air most often feels oppressive.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 54 min at the start of March to 12 h 06 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, March is Zaïbo's 6th-clearest and 3rd-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Zaïbo's year-round climate.

Location & terrain

Where is Zaïbo?

Zaïbo sits at 7.0°N, 6.7°W, 226 m above sea level, in Ivory Coast. The nearest listed city is Boboniessoko, 3.0 km away.

Topography around Zaïbo

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Zaïbo.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Zaïbo has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 55 m around an average of 233 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 90 m; within 80 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 807 m.

The land around Zaïbo is covered by trees (54%) and grassland (29%) within 3 km, trees (67%) and grassland (21%) within 16 km, and trees (82%) within 80 km.
